S82.034R (Nondisplaced transverse fracture of right patella, subsequent encounter for open fracture type IIIA, IIIB, or IIIC with malunion)
compared with
S82.035R (Nondisplaced transverse fracture of left patella, subsequent encounter for open fracture type IIIA, IIIB, or IIIC with malunion),
from the official CMS tabular data. S82.034R and S82.035R code the same condition on opposite sides.
Nondisplaced transverse fracture of left patella, subsequent encounter for open fracture type IIIA, IIIB, or IIIC with malunion
Same condition; these differ only in which side is documented.
These codes share a category and title and differ only in the side affected. The documentation decides which applies, and a bilateral code is reported only where the code set provides one.
